C#读写Ini文件

using System;
using System.Collections.Generic;
using System.Text;
using System.Runtime.InteropServices;
using System.Collections.Specialized;
using System.IO;

namespace EstartManage
{
public class IniFiles
{
public string FileName; //INI文件名
//声明读写INI文件的API函数
[DllImport("kernel32")]
private static extern bool WritePrivateProfileString(string section, string key, string val, string filePath);
[DllImport("kernel32")]
private static extern int GetPrivateProfileString(string section, string key, string def, byte[] retVal, int size, string filePath);
/// <summary>
/// 构造函数,初始化文件名
/// </summary>
/// <param name="AFileName"></param>
public IniFiles(string AFileName)
{

FileInfo fileInfo = new FileInfo(AFileName);
// 判断文件是否存在
if ((!fileInfo.Exists))
{
//文件不存在,建立文件
System.IO.StreamWriter sw = new System.IO.StreamWriter(AFileName, false, System.Text.Encoding.Default);
try
{
sw.Write("#=====================");
sw.Close();
}

catch
{
throw (new ApplicationException("Ini文件不存在"));
}
}
//必须是完全路径
FileName = fileInfo.FullName;
}
/// <summary>
/// 写文件
/// </summary>
/// <param name="Section"></param>
/// <param name="Ident"></param>
/// <param name="Value"></param>
public void WriteString(string Section, string Ident, string Value)
{
if (!WritePrivateProfileString(Section, Ident, Value, FileName))
{

throw (new ApplicationException("写Ini文件出错"));
}
}
/// <summary>
/// 读字符串
/// </summary>
/// <param name="Section"></param>
/// <param name="Ident"></param>
/// <param name="Default"></param>
/// <returns></returns>
public string ReadString(string Section, string Ident, string Default)
{
Byte[] Buffer = new Byte[65535];
int bufLen = GetPrivateProfileString(Section, Ident, Default, Buffer, Buffer.GetUpperBound(0), FileName);
//必须设定0(系统默认的代码页)的编码方式,否则无法支持中文
string s = Encoding.GetEncoding(0).GetString(Buffer);
s = s.Substring(0, bufLen);
return s.Trim();
}

/// <summary>
/// 读整数
/// </summary>
/// <param name="Section"></param>
/// <param name="Ident"></param>
/// <param name="Default"></param>
/// <returns></returns>
public int ReadInteger(string Section, string Ident, int Default)
{
string intStr = ReadString(Section, Ident, Convert.ToString(Default));
try
{
return Convert.ToInt32(intStr);

}
catch (Exception ex)
{
Console.WriteLine(ex.Message);
return Default;
}
}

/// <summary>
/// 写整数
/// </summary>
/// <param name="Section"></param>
/// <param name="Ident"></param>
/// <param name="Value"></param>
public void WriteInteger(string Section, string Ident, int Value)
{
WriteString(Section, Ident, Value.ToString());
}

/// <summary>
/// 读布尔值
/// </summary>
/// <param name="Section"></param>
/// <param name="Ident"></param>
/// <param name="Default"></param>
/// <returns></returns>
public bool ReadBool(string Section, string Ident, bool Default)
{
try
{
return Convert.ToBoolean(ReadString(Section, Ident, Convert.ToString(Default)));
}
catch (Exception ex)
{
Console.WriteLine(ex.Message);
return Default;
}
}

/// <summary>
/// 写Bool值
/// </summary>
/// <param name="Section"></param>
/// <param name="Ident"></param>
/// <param name="Value"></param>
public void WriteBool(string Section, string Ident, bool Value)
{
WriteString(Section, Ident, Convert.ToString(Value));
}

/// <summary>
/// 从Ini文件中,将指定的Section名称中的所有Ident添加到列表中
/// </summary>
/// <param name="Section"></param>
/// <param name="Idents"></param>
public void ReadSection(string Section, StringCollection Idents)
{
Byte[] Buffer = new Byte[16384];
//Idents.Clear();

int bufLen = GetPrivateProfileString(Section, null, null, Buffer, Buffer.GetUpperBound(0),
FileName);
//对Section进行解析
GetStringsFromBuffer(Buffer, bufLen, Idents);
}

private void GetStringsFromBuffer(Byte[] Buffer, int bufLen, StringCollection Strings)
{
Strings.Clear();
if (bufLen != 0)
{
int start = 0;
for (int i = 0; i < bufLen; i++)
{
if ((Buffer[i] == 0) && ((i - start) > 0))
{
String s = Encoding.GetEncoding(0).GetString(Buffer, start, i - start);
Strings.Add(s);
start = i + 1;
}
}
}
}
/// <summary>
/// 读取所有的Sections的名称
/// </summary>
/// <param name="SectionList"></param>
public void ReadSections(StringCollection SectionList)
{
//Note:必须得用Bytes来实现,StringBuilder只能取到第一个Section
byte[] Buffer = new byte[65535];
int bufLen = 0;
bufLen = GetPrivateProfileString(null, null, null, Buffer,
Buffer.GetUpperBound(0), FileName);
GetStringsFromBuffer(Buffer, bufLen, SectionList);
}
/// <summary>
/// 读取指定的Section的所有Value到列表中
/// </summary>
/// <param name="Section"></param>
/// <param name="Values"></param>
public void ReadSectionValues(string Section, NameValueCollection Values)
{
StringCollection KeyList = new StringCollection();
ReadSection(Section, KeyList);
Values.Clear();
foreach (string key in KeyList)
{
Values.Add(key, ReadString(Section, key, ""));

}
}
/// <summary>
/// 读取指定的Section的所有Value到列表中
/// </summary>
/// <param name="Section"></param>
/// <param name="Values"></param>
/// <param name="splitString"></param>
public void ReadSectionValues(string Section, NameValueCollection Values, char splitString)
{
//string sectionValue;
//string[] sectionValueSplit;
//StringCollection KeyList = new StringCollection();
//ReadSection(Section, KeyList);
//Values.Clear();
//foreach (string key in KeyList)
//{
//    sectionValue = ReadString(Section, key, "");
//    sectionValueSplit = sectionValue.Split(splitString);
//    Values.Add(key, sectionValueSplit[0].ToString(), sectionValueSplit[1].ToString());

//}
}
/// <summary>
/// 清除某个Section
/// </summary>
/// <param name="Section"></param>
public void EraseSection(string Section)
{
//
if (!WritePrivateProfileString(Section, null, null, FileName))
{

throw (new ApplicationException("无法清除Ini文件中的Section"));
}
}
/// <summary>
/// 删除某个Section下的键
/// </summary>
/// <param name="Section"></param>
/// <param name="Ident"></param>
public void DeleteKey(string Section, string Ident)
{
WritePrivateProfileString(Section, Ident, null, FileName);
}
/// <summary>
/// 对于Win9X,来说需要实现UpdateFile方法将缓冲中的数据写入文件
/// 在Win NT, 2000和XP上,都是直接写文件,没有缓冲,所以,无须实现UpdateFile
/// 执行完对Ini文件的修改之后,应该调用本方法更新缓冲区。
/// </summary>
public void UpdateFile()
{
WritePrivateProfileString(null, null, null, FileName);
}

/// <summary>
/// 检查某个Section下的某个键值是否存在
/// </summary>
/// <param name="Section"></param>
/// <param name="Ident"></param>
/// <returns></returns>
public bool ValueExists(string Section, string Ident)
{
//
StringCollection Idents = new StringCollection();
ReadSection(Section, Idents);
return Idents.IndexOf(Ident) > -1;
}

/// <summary>
/// 确保资源的释放
/// </summary>
~IniFiles()
{
UpdateFile();
}
}

}


Ini文件的好处在于软件的绿色化,可以把写入注册表的某些值替换写在ini文件中
